Transaction c6fd76402a2cc16bf0d846927e29eca161db44215da9472a58c52417d9a26da9
1 Input
1 Output
-
c6fd76402a2cc16bf0d846927e29eca161db44215da9472a58c52417d9a26da9:0
- value
- 734238
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e12d1c90686831d9ba552a821820b79a8a636666 OP_EQUAL
- address
- 3NDe17WTWDwqD9UVQqvt4m6L4dLMdSyd5B